Through the Broadband Challenge Portal, the public can answer a series of questions about internet service available at a given location, upload evidence to support a potential challenge, take and submit the results of a speed test, and/or submit a free text comment about the quality of their internet service.

WHY IS THIS IMPORTANT?

Creating accurate broadband coverage maps is critical to ensure everyone in New York is covered. Past inaccurate versions have hurt communities by misallocating valuable resources, so it is important we all make sure NY gets it right this time around!
